Server Tags & Filters
This is probably the biggest quality-of-life improvement. Every server on UOAddicts (all 55 of them) is now tagged with:
- PvP type — PvP, PvE Only, Consensual PvP, Felucca Only
- Map type — Original or Custom
- Era — T2A, Renaissance, AoS, Custom
- Emulator — ServUO, RunUO, ModernUO, Sphere, POL, Broadsword
- Skill cap — 700, 720, or no cap
- Language — English, Portuguese, German, Russian, and more
And the server list page now has a full filter bar. Click "PvE Only" and "Custom Map" and boom — you see exactly the servers that match. If you have a preferred server set, it pins to the top with a little star badge. Check it out at [/servers](https://uoaddicts.com/servers).

Behind the Scenes — Admin Tools
I also did a full admin overhaul. Shared navigation across all admin pages, color-coded audit logs, content removal that actually works now (before it was only marking reports as reviewed but not hiding the content... oops). There's a new admin scripts page for managing anonymous uploads, role management, shadow ban and full ban system with session invalidation, and a blocked email list that auto-blocks on ban. Pretty much everything an admin would need to keep the community healthy.
